Transaction fae62586bb640fed3a4f1f626c5aa355ee996e020da11fe2b2c749e7e49ec9cb
1 Input
1 Output
-
fae62586bb640fed3a4f1f626c5aa355ee996e020da11fe2b2c749e7e49ec9cb:0
- value
- 39508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1e88d7201459b88d44b3e12c5f75e915e10ccfb OP_EQUAL
- address
- 3KNJvbimqb1d9TEj7RiHimQTi3iCieVa3G